The technical tools used in stock trading in the UK

The stock market is a volatile and everchanging environment, and having the right tools can make a huge difference in success. Technical tools such as actual time stock market data, charting tools, trading platforms, analytical software and automated trading systems are essential for traders looking to make profitable investments.

This article will look at the importance of each of these technical tools and discuss how they can be used to enhance trading performance in the UK. Real-time stock market data

Real-time stock market data offers investors up-to-date information about securities, including prices, volume, dividends and news events. Using this data, investors can make informed decisions when making trades, as they can access comprehensive information on performance trends.

Additionally, this data allows them to monitor their existing holdings, giving them insight into how their investments perform. This data also makes it possible for investors to identify potential opportunities in the market, allowing them to capitalise on them.

Charting tools

Investors use charting tools to identify patterns in a security’s price movements. Tracking securities’ performance over time allows traders to recognize potential buying or selling opportunities. These tools also provide technical indicators such as moving averages, relative strength indexes and stochastic oscillators that traders use to gauge market sentiment.

Furthermore, charting tools often provide back-testing capabilities, allowing traders to test strategies in simulated trading environments.

Trading platforms

Trading platforms give investors access to multiple exchanges and markets, allowing them to place orders quickly and efficiently. This allows traders to manage their portfolios with minimal effort, enabling them to capitalise on short-term trading opportunities.

Additionally, these platforms allow investors to review past trades and analyse their performance with enhanced reporting capabilities. Trading platforms also provide risk management features, allowing investors to set up trading limits and stop losses.

Analytical software

Analytical software allows investors to analyse large data sets and uncover trends in the market. This type of software can be used to identify opportunities in the market, as well as help traders develop trading strategies that are tailored to their individual preferences.

Additionally, analytical software can back-test strategies before putting them into practice. Analytical software can also be used to track the performance of individual portfolios when stocks trading, allowing investors to make informed decisions when making trades. Finally, it can be used to monitor news events, providing investors with a better understanding of the factors that could affect their investments.

Automated trading systems

Automated trading systems allow traders to automate their trading process without manually monitoring or adjusting their positions. These systems enable investors to set up rules for entering and exiting trades, allowing them to take advantage of short-term price movements without constantly monitoring the markets.

Automated trading systems also provide risk management features, making it easier for investors to manage their portfolio risks while taking advantage of potential opportunities in the market.

All in all

The technical tools used in stock trading in the UK can provide investors with several advantages. Real-time data and charting tools allow investors to track market performance trends, while trading platforms allow them to place orders quickly and efficiently.

On top of that, analytical software helps traders identify potential opportunities, while automated trading systems enable them to automate their trades without constantly monitoring the markets. By utilising these tools, investors can gain an edge over other traders and improve their chances of success when making trades.

Ultimately, however, it is up to individual investors to decide which tools best suit their needs and how they can be used most effectively. They must take the time to research each tool available and understand how it can be used to make better-informed investment decisions. By doing so, they can ensure that their trading strategies yield the best possible returns in the long run.
